eclipse导入整个项目eclipse 项目编译 过程
    Eclipse是一种常用的集成开发环境(IDE),用于开发Java应用程序和其他语言的项目。在Eclipse中,项目编译是指将源代码转换为可执行的应用程序或库的过程。下面我将从多个角度来回答你关于Eclipse项目编译过程的问题。
    1. 项目设置和配置:
    在Eclipse中,首先需要设置和配置项目的编译选项。你可以通过项目的属性对话框来指定编译器版本、编译路径、编译选项等。这些设置将影响编译过程中的行为和结果。
    2. 构建过程:
    Eclipse使用自动化构建系统来编译项目。当你保存源代码时,Eclipse会自动检测变更并触发编译过程。编译过程涉及以下几个步骤:
      a. 语法检查,Eclipse会首先检查源代码的语法错误,并在编辑器中显示错误提示。这有助于及早发现并纠正语法错误。
      b. 编译源代码,一旦通过了语法检查,Eclipse会将源代码编译成字节码文件(.class文件)。编译过程中会检查类型错误、引用错误等,并生成相应的编译错误或警告。
      c. 生成输出,编译成功后,Eclipse会将编译生成的字节码文件输出到指定的输出目录。这些字节码文件可以在运行时被Java虚拟机(JVM)加载和执行。
    3. 错误和警告处理:
    在编译过程中,Eclipse会捕获并显示编译错误和警告。错误表示严重的问题,会阻止项目的成功编译。警告表示潜在的问题,可能会导致运行时错误或不良的代码质量。你可以通过Eclipse的问题视图来查看和处理这些错误和警告,以确保项目的正确性和质量。
    4. 依赖管理:
    在大型项目中,通常会有多个模块或库之间存在依赖关系。Eclipse提供了依赖管理功能,可以帮助你管理项目所需的外部依赖。你可以通过添加相关的库文件或配置依赖关系来确保项目能够正确编译和运行。
    5. 自动构建和增量编译:
    Eclipse支持自动构建和增量编译功能,这意味着只有发生变更的文件才会被重新编译。这样可以提高编译的效率,避免不必要的重复工作。
    总结:
    Eclipse项目编译过程涉及项目设置和配置、构建过程、错误和警告处理、依赖管理,以及自动构建和增量编译等方面。通过合理配置和处理,可以确保项目的正确编译和质量控制。以上是关于Eclipse项目编译过程的一个全面回答,希望对你有所帮助。